分类
-
- 2025-11-30
- Go语言递归函数返回值处理:二叉树查找的正确实践
针对Go语言中递归函数返回值未正确传递导致的问题,本文通过一个二叉树查找的实例,详细解释了在递归调用中如何确保返回值能沿着调用栈正确回溯。文章将分析常见错误模式,并提供修正后的代码示例,强调在递归分支中显式return递...Read More -
- 2025-11-30
- 深入理解随机递归函数的基准行为与时间复杂度
本文深入探讨了一个看似具有随机性的递归函数,揭示了其基准情况(basecase)被触发次数的确定性规律。通过分析函数构建的满二叉递归树结构,并运用归纳法证明,我们发现树的内部节点数量始终等于初始参数n,从而推导出叶子节点...Read More -
- 2025-11-30
- 分析随机参数递归函数:基线条件计数与时间复杂度解析
本文深入探讨了一个使用随机参数进行分治的递归函数。我们将揭示为何其基线条件(basecase)的执行次数,尽管涉及随机性,却始终保持恒定。通过分析递归树的结构,特别是证明输入n等同于内部节点的数量,并结合满二叉树的性质,...Read More -
- 2025-11-29
- 深入理解随机递归函数的确定性:内部节点、叶节点与时间复杂度分
本教程深入探讨了一个看似随机的递归JavaScript函数fuc1,该函数尽管使用随机参数进行递归调用,却始终以可预测的次数触发其基准情况。我们将分析其递归树结构,证明它是一个满二叉树,并通过归纳法推导出内部节点和叶节点...Read More -
- 2025-11-29
- 分析随机分支递归函数的确定性基准情况与时间复杂度
本文深入探讨了一个看似具有随机行为的递归JavaScript函数,但其基准情况(basecase)的触发次数却始终保持不变。我们将揭示该函数如何构建一个全二叉递归树,并通过归纳法证明其内部节点数量等于输入参数n,进而推导...Read More -
- 2025-11-28
- c++ 二叉树遍历代码 c++前序中序后序递归
二叉树的三种遍历方式为前序、中序、后序,均可用递归实现:前序访问根后遍历左右子树,中序先左再根后右,后序左右子树完成后访问根。Read More


